Learning to Network and Interview Successfully- Graduate Students

November 2, 2017 @ 10:00 am - 1:30 pm

Co-hosted by the Graduate School, Training Initiatives in Biological and Biomedical Science (TIBBS), and University Career Services.

Although most people realize the importance of networking and interviewing well for proactively managing their careers, many do not have a clear plan for doing so. Frankly, most people simply don’t have the time to create a plan—leading to an approach that is haphazard, at best. In this half-day workshop, three Ph.D.-level coaches present on how to network and interview successfully by encouraging participants to be intentional, authentic, and articulate in their networking and interviewing process. Equipped with those three tenets, job seekers become empowered and confident as they manage their careers and conduct a job search campaign.
